Aarklash, a world at war

It was an age where time did not exist ... The age of the gods. The gods travelled the Creation unrivalled. Their empires knew no limit and extended over entire worlds born from the magic energies of the Creation. Discord came and the gods waged war among themselves for supremacy. The crumbling of the dying worlds almost led to the collapse of the Creation and the death of everything. The Creation fought back. The gods were brutally thrown off their thrones and sent into exile beyond the borders of the elemental worlds, Realms. Time appeared, imposing its curse to the vain immortals: if they dared to reappear, they would suffer the punishment and would be forever forgotten. Thus, the age of the gods ended.

However, one does not get rid of these terrible forces so easily. After thousands of years in exile, the gods continue to wage war through their champions - Incarnates - and their most faithful allies. The balance is once again under threat. The curse of Time is fading. Darkness seizes the heart of the brave and the gods get ready to lead their armies. The ultimate age has come : the Rag'Narok

A continent lost in darkness

Not far from the heart of the Creation is a sought after Kingdom: Aarklash. Magic thresholds can be opened there to travel to all the Realms, including those where the gods are imprisoned. The future of the Creation is linked to the fate of this singular world. The history of the continent of Aarklash was written by the victors of the great wars of the past. The glory and the prestige of the conquerors of long gone eras hide fratricide wars and dreadful lies. The nations of Aarklash were built on pain, blood and treachery. Some nations did not resist the erosion of Time. From their ashes, larger and stronger empires arose, yet also younger and drawn towards the warlike temptations of power.

The war Lords of Aarklash cured the wounds inherited from their fathers and gathered armies for the end of the world. All are getting ready for the Rag’narok, a merciless war announced by ancient prophecies, but of which the mortals still ignore the real stakes..
